I thought I'd stick a needle with a "modified calcineurin inhibitor" in it into this old thread and bring up some old memories of participating in the ARG for FlashForward.

I want to bring up Apo's find back on Aug. 12 2009 over at the truthhack website where he found some info on the ARG:

Quote:
A bit of info on some of the Mosaic Task Force (MTF).
Stanford Wedeck
• MTF Head
• transferred from D.C. to the Los Angeles Field Office in 2001
• canny investigator
• astute player in the D.C. game is well known throughout this country’s circles of power

Mark Benford
• MTF Lead Investigator
• former Cleveland cop
• known as a respected workhorse who tends to fly under the radar

Marcie Turoff
• MTF analyst and spokesperson at Comic-Con
• former chess prodigy
• strong background in pattern recognition
--------------------------------------------------------------

With Marcie Turoff being a "former chess prodigy" and us knowing from the last episode of Better Angels (114) that Dyson Frost became a chess grandmaster at 15 (the same age as Bobby Fischer btw), we have evidence from the ARG that Marcie might be our mole that is supposed to be exposed in tonight's episode of Queen's Sacrifice (115).
